WebRhynchophorus depressus Chevrolat. Rhynchophorus languinosus Chevrolat. The South American palm weevil, Rhynchophorus palmarum, is a species of snout beetle. The adults are relatively large black beetles of approximately one and a half inch in length, and the larvae may grow to two inches in length. First sightings in Cali-fornia were from mature 30-50 year old Canary Island date palms in landscape … WebMar 17, 2024 · Canary Island date palms have a few insect pests that prey on them, including scale insects, the palmetto weevil, and the palm leaf skeletonizer. Diseases that they are susceptible to include phytophthora bud rot, lethal yellowing, and magnesium deficiency, which can be dealt with by using a fertilizer that is high in magnesium.

WebThe Situation: The South American palm weevil, Rhynchophorus palmarum (Coleoptera: Curculionidae), has a known distribution that includes Mexico, Central and South America, and the Caribbean. Like other species of Rhynchophorus, such as the red palm weevil, R. ferrugineus, and the palm weevil R. vulneratus, R. palmarum is a destructive palm ... WebMar 19, 2024 · Lethal bronzing, a disease of several types of palms, is present in Lake County. ... In fact, 16 palms are known hosts to the disease including the popular Canary Island date, queen, and pindo palms.
